On Sunday, July 27, 2025, at approximately 7:47 AM, a sideswipe collision (same direction) occurred on I-270 EB, near MM 0.799, ADAMS County, Colorado. 2 vehicles were involved in the property damage only-level incident, which resulted in no reported injuries. Clear weather conditions and daylight lighting were noted at the time of the crash.
